ServiceNow QA Analyst
About the role
As a ServiceNow QA Analyst, you will make an impact by ensuring the quality, reliability, and performance of ServiceNow solutions throughout the software development lifecycle. You will be a valued member of the Quality Assurance team and work collaboratively with developers, business analysts, project stakeholders, and clients to deliver high-quality digital solutions.
In this role, you will:
- Create and execute test plans, test cases, and test scripts to validate functional and non-functional requirements.
- Identify, document, and track defects while ensuring timely resolution and clear communication with project teams.
- Review requirements and system specifications to ensure complete test coverage and alignment with client expectations.
- Validate user interfaces, workflows, and integrations to ensure consistency, usability, and functionality.
- Apply Agile testing practices and contribute to continuous improvements in quality assurance processes.
Additional responsibilities for QA Analyst
- Lead quality assurance activities across complex projects with minimal supervision.
- Proactively identify risks, gaps, and quality concerns throughout the development lifecycle.
- Partner with stakeholders to recommend testing strategies and quality improvements.
- Support the development and refinement of QA standards, processes, and best practices.

What you need to have to be considered
- Bachelor's degree in Software Engineering, Computer Science, Information Technology, Mathematics, Engineering, or a related field.
- Experience in software quality assurance and testing methodologies.
- Experience creating and executing test cases, test plans, and defect management processes.
- Understanding of Agile development methodologies and sprint-based delivery environments.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with excellent attention to detail.
- Effective written and verbal communication skills.
QA Analyst
- 2 to 6 years of experience in software quality assurance or testing.
- Proven ability to work independently across multiple projects or complex engagements.
- Experience identifying testing risks and driving quality initiatives proactively.
These will help you stand out
- Experience testing ServiceNow applications and workflows.
- ServiceNow Certified System Administrator (CSA) certification.
- ITIL Foundation certification.
- Scrum or Agile-related certifications.
- Experience with test automation tools and frameworks.
- Experience testing web and mobile applications.
